Pacific Polytechnic College, Udaipur, is a constituent college that is committed to offering quality technical education in engineering disciplines. The AICTE-recognised college provides five diploma courses in different engineering streams. The Pacific Polytechnic College admission process is kept simple and open to aspiring students.
The Pacific Polytechnic College usually holds admissions for the academic session beginning approximately around July-August. Although specific dates are different, potential students are recommended to prepare their applications in advance, typically from March to April.
Admission requirements for diploma courses at Pacific Polytechnic College usually are: Passing of 10+2 or equivalent examination from a recognised board Minimum percentage in aggregate and concerned subjects (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ics) as defined by the college Age limit as per AICTE guidelines (generally between 17 and 25 years) Pacific Polytechnic College Application Process Pacific Polytechnic College, Udaipur, application process includes the following steps: Get the application form: Potential applicants can get the application form either from the college campus or from the college website.
Complete the application form: Fill in all the necessary details in the application form carefully. Make sure that the information given is accurate and current. Application submission: Submit the filled-up application form and all the supporting documents to the admissions office of the college. This can be done personally or through registered mail.
Payment of application fee: Pay the application fee as stipulated by the college. The fee can be paid in the form of a demand draft or an online payment mode. Entrance exam or merit list: Based on the present admission policy of the college, students will have to attend an entrance exam or will be selected on the basis of their 10+2 marks.
Document verification: Shortlisted candidates will be invited for document verification. Keep all original documents in hand for the purpose. Counselling and seat allocation: Shortlisted candidates may have to attend a counselling session to be allocated to a programme as per their preference and seats available.
Payment of fees and confirmation of admission: After seat allocation, candidates have to pay the fees due within the time limit to secure their admission. Orientation and classes commencement: Students admitted will be notified regarding the orientation programme and date of commencement of classes.
Pacific Polytechnic College Diploma Admission Process Pacific Polytechnic College has five diploma programmes, each lasting three years and having an intake capacity of 60 students per programme. The Pacific Polytechnic College admission process for all diploma programmes is uniform with minor variations depending on the specialisation chosen.
